A Study On The Current Situation And Practice Of The Use Of Correction Books In Junior Middle School Mathematics

Mathematics is a very important subject,which runs through the student's learning career,and shares a large proportion.The significance of learning mathematics well is self-evident,but it is not a good way to rely on the sea of stuffing exercises.Tired and disgusted,and students cannot get good grades.Summarizing it carefully and treat the errors they meet seriously to help students grasp the exercises best.Accumulating and building their own error correction books to contribute to their subsequent.In this essay,we send questionnaires to students in the eighth and ninth grades of Nancheng Junior High School in this county to learn about students' attitudes towards the establishment and usage of math correction books,teachers' guidance,and problems they face.At the same time,communicating with math teachers in the same school and let them give some advice to learn about the roles teachers play in the process of building and using of correction books.In order to verify whether the countermeasures proposed and established by the author after the previous interviews and questionnaire surveys can achieve the desired effect,the 114 seven graders of Nancheng Junior High School were selected as experimental subjects,and formulating corresponding practices,based on the previous study.The conclusions in the paper are as follows:(I)Results of Investigation and Research on Mathematical Mistake Management of Junior Middle School Students(1)Most students have a positive attitude towards the establishment of mathematics error correction books.The ninth grade students have a more sober and positive understanding of the establishment and usage of error correction books,and have a better understanding of the role of error correction books.(2)The self-control activity of students in the low-score group is weaker than that in the high-score group.Teachers need to instruct in layers in the process of guiding students to establish and use error correction books,especially focusing on the middle-score group and the low-score group;(3)Teachers are absent from monitoring the usage of student correction books.There is no systemic solution and the time duration is insufficient.(4)Students' wrong questions are handled in the following ways:(1)ignore them;(2)modify directly next to the wrong questions;(3)mark the key questions after modification,such as highlighting a red pen or making special marks;(4)correct the wrong questions Excerpt or cut to a new book;(5)The teacher will ask similar questions to consolidate after answering;(6)excerpt the classic wrong questions together.The methods of dealing with the wrong questions of students at different levels do not exist in isolation,but are combined with each other.(II)Results of practical research on the usage of mathematics error correction books for junior high school studentsIn order to verify whether the countermeasures proposed and established by the author after the previous interviews and questionnaire surveys can achieve the desired results,the114 students in the seventh grade of Nancheng Junior High School were selected as experimental subjects,and the corresponding practices were formulated to develop corresponding practices The results prove that the practice scheme is effective,and students' performance and learning ability have been significantly improved.
